I've also valued major collections relating to soccer, Olympics, tennis and cricket. | Peoples Paraphernalia began about 25 years ago, when a couple of fellows were passing through the smalll township of Talbot, near Ballarat in Victoria. (The highway now bypasses the town). They simply dropped in to the general store to get an icecream on a hot day. Talking to the store owner, they discovered that the store was actually closing that day. In the store, they saw dolls with original price tags of 7/6 (seven shillings and six pence) crossed out, with 75cents new prices in place! Before they knew it (or why!), they'd bought the contents of the shop for what proved to be a bargain price.
After they fillied a pan-tech with all the goods in the store, the owner said "What about all the stuff in the sheds out back?" Another truck full! For many years, these fellow hired out the items they'd found to TV and film production companies. Finally, they decided to get out of the hiring business, and we (Marg & Rick) purchased the lot! It filled a warehouse!
